Skip to content

Conversation

@ZPain8464
Copy link
Contributor

@ZPain8464 ZPain8464 commented Jun 4, 2024

This PR restructures the docs IA for Zero. It:

  • Moves IdP guides, Integrations guides to the Guides sidebar
  • Splits up Guides into the following subsections:
    • Upstream Services
    • External Data Sources
    • Courses
    • Identity Providers
    • Configure Pomerium
  • Removes Securing TCP-based Services, and adds an additional Postgres example to capabilities/tcp/examples/postgres
  • Removes the JS SDK guide
  • Removes Local OIDC guide
  • Splits up concepts/certificates into an mTLS guide under guides/certificates; the body content from the original page will be repurposed into a resources piece on the Marketing site
  • Moves "Core" courses fundamentals to the Guides subsection (will replace with Zero courses in another PR)
  • Moves the External Data Sources page to Capabilities
  • Adds a Zero Install page with the onboarding instructions for each deployment environment
  • Moves nested product directories to the top, including:
    • Core
    • Enterprise
    • Clients
    • Kubernetes
    • Zero
  • Moves Cluster Status to the Troubleshooting directory
  • Removes "Deploy"
  • Fixes broken links and adds redirects

@ZPain8464 ZPain8464 requested a review from a team as a code owner June 4, 2024 13:36
@ZPain8464 ZPain8464 requested review from cmo-pomerium and removed request for a team June 4, 2024 13:36
@netlify
Copy link

netlify bot commented Jun 4, 2024

Deploy Preview for pomerium-docs ready!

Name Link
🔨 Latest commit 4b8f154
🔍 Latest deploy log https://app.netlify.com/sites/pomerium-docs/deploys/6671b092e477b40008301083
😎 Deploy Preview https://deploy-preview-1439--pomerium-docs.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site configuration.

@ZPain8464 ZPain8464 changed the title WIP -- Zero IA Adds new Zero IA Jun 18, 2024
@ZPain8464 ZPain8464 requested a review from desimone June 18, 2024 16:15
@ZPain8464 ZPain8464 requested a review from kenjenkins June 18, 2024 16:15
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ants